The global thermal management system market has emerged as a critical component of modern industrial and consumer electronics infrastructure. As technology advances and devices become more sophisticated, the need for effective temperature control solutions has become paramount. According to a comprehensive market analysis, the thermal management system market was valued at USD 56.72 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 95.64 billion by 2032, expanding at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.1% throughout the forecast period.
Thermal management refers to the comprehensive set of tools and techniques employed to maintain optimal operating temperatures within electronic and mechanical systems. In the context of electronic devices, thermal management primarily focuses on dissipating excess heat to prevent equipment degradation and failure. Most modern electronic systems generate substantial heat during operation, and without proper heat dissipation mechanisms, sensitive internal components can suffer irreversible damage.
The significance of thermal management extends beyond preventing overheating. Electronic components are equally vulnerable to excessive environmental heat exposure. Outdoor applications and harsh climate conditions can elevate component temperatures beyond acceptable thresholds, compromising functionality and reducing device lifespan. This dual challenge—managing internally generated heat and protecting against external thermal stress—drives the demand for sophisticated thermal management solutions across multiple industries.
Thermal management solutions have become indispensable across diverse industrial sectors. The automotive industry represents one of the largest adopters, utilizing advanced cooling systems to manage heat generated by engines, batteries, and electrical components. The aerospace and aviation sectors depend on precision thermal control to ensure aircraft safety and performance at extreme altitudes. Consumer electronics manufacturers implement thermal management technologies in smartphones, laptops, and gaming devices to enhance performance and user experience.
Additional critical applications include data centers, where massive computational infrastructure generates extraordinary heat loads. Medical equipment manufacturers incorporate thermal management systems to maintain precise operating conditions for diagnostic and therapeutic devices. Battery systems, particularly in electric vehicles and renewable energy storage, require sophisticated temperature regulation to maximize efficiency and extend operational lifespan.
The rising demand for thermal management systems across these diverse applications—from advanced vehicles to sophisticated aircraft, consumer electronics, and medical equipment—represents a primary catalyst for market expansion during the forecast period.
The Asia Pacific region has established itself as the dominant force in the thermal management system market, commanding a substantial market share of 57.49% in 2023. This dominance reflects the region's concentration of manufacturing hubs, particularly in countries like China, Japan, South Korea, and India. The region's leading position is further strengthened by the rapid expansion of the automotive, consumer electronics, and semiconductor industries across Asia Pacific nations.
North America and Europe represent significant secondary markets, driven by technological advancement, stringent environmental regulations, and robust demand from aerospace and automotive sectors. The Middle East, South America, and other emerging markets are progressively increasing their adoption of thermal management technologies as industrialization accelerates and technology penetration deepens.
A transformative trend reshaping the thermal management landscape involves the integration of electromagnetic interference (EMI) shielding with thermal management capabilities. As various industries transition toward higher frequency applications, traditional EMI shielding methods prove insufficient. The evolution of 5G telecommunications infrastructure and automotive radar systems, which operate at frequencies exceeding 24 GHz, necessitates advanced solutions that simultaneously address thermal and electromagnetic challenges.
5G deployment continues accelerating globally, though infrastructure for the highest frequency waves remains in early development stages. Most existing 5G infrastructure operates within lower frequency bands below 6 GHz. However, as deployment advances and higher frequencies become standard, hybrid solutions that combine EMI protection with thermal dissipation will become increasingly valuable.
Automotive radar systems, a fundamental component of Advanced Driver Assistance Systems, generate significant heat while operating at higher frequencies required for enhanced resolution detection capabilities. This creates demand for innovative thermal management solutions specifically designed for automotive applications. The convergence of electrification, autonomous capabilities, and advanced sensor systems in modern vehicles intensifies thermal management demands.
The COVID-19 pandemic temporarily disrupted thermal management system market growth, particularly affecting aerospace and defense sectors. Government-mandated lockdowns classified aviation and defense services as non-essential, leading to production interruptions and reduced sales. However, global markets demonstrated resilience, and the market has recovered substantially with renewed growth momentum.
The thermal management system market encompasses multiple technology approaches and equipment categories. Active cooling technologies employ powered mechanisms such as compressors and fans to regulate temperature, while passive cooling relies on natural heat transfer through conduction and convection without active energy input.
Equipment categories include heat exchangers, compressors, heat pipes and hoses, evaporators, pumps and control valves, accumulators and reservoirs, purge and fill systems, filters, motor controllers, and complementary technologies. Each equipment category serves specific applications and operates across distinct market segments.
